Guineafowl meat is drier and leaner than chicken meat and has a gamey flavour. It's got marginally additional protein than chicken or turkey, around half the Extra fat of chicken and a little less energy per gram.[ten] Their eggs are substantially richer than All those of chickens.[eleven]

Guineafowl may very well be properly trained to go into a coop (as opposed to roosting in trees) when quite youthful. When hatched and ready to depart the brooder (close to 3 months), they may be enclosed inside of a coop for a minimum of 3 times so they learn in which "residence" is.
